Output efc6ee57679883b9d80a4ed089c64c0600a252beaf97c3cc33f220900ad92b70:42

value
481756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 278eb082f617d0878aac564fe28dfca4600ea819 OP_EQUAL
address
35JBDGLh8z4kpg2u5pQpECxfTnoMBkGTbM
transaction
efc6ee57679883b9d80a4ed089c64c0600a252beaf97c3cc33f220900ad92b70
confirmations
283114
spent
true